Abstract
We propose a fair novel concurrent signature scheme. It resolves the existing problems in traditional concurrent signature schemes, that is initial signer (A) has some advantages over matching signer (B), such as A could show B´s ambiguous signature and the keystone to a third party in private to demonstrate B´s binding signature but B can not, or A could keep the keystone secret and B do not have power to force A to release it. In our scheme, the keystones were produced by both A and B, that is to say, the two participants in our scheme have equal positions, no one has any priority than the other, so our scheme can achieve the fairness of both sides.
